I'd pay
There is ton of content I'd buy online if it were available. Still I prefer the CD or DVD over a download but there is tons of content out there that just isn't viable on DVD. There are TV shows that would sell good for reasonable price on bit torrent that can't be sold on DVD for a reasonable price due to lack of demand. But sell me the content online and have me pay to download and burn the DVD for a small hosting fee well there you go with a viable business model.

Of course they will try to do it like I-Tunes I bet. Same price as buying the CD and only selling 90% of the stuff that you can already get cheaply on DVD. I mean if they try to sell old movies for more than buck they have a loser. I can pick up two older movies and Walmart for $6.88. By older movies I mean movies released a year or two ago. All last summers movies are selling for under $10 now. What will the price be on Bit torrent.

Makes you wonder about these pirates. I can buy a lot of movies for the cost of that high speed internet connection and the time I spend isn't free either. That's like 20+ movies a month I can buy or I can waste my time pirating. Who's the idiot there? Risk fines to spend money pirating. Not smart in the slightest if you ask me. Then again who said criminals were smart....
